Asphalt Shingles in Denver

Asphalt shingles are the most common roofing material on Denver homes, but they don’t behave here the same way they do in other parts of the country. Between hailstorms, intense sun at elevation, strong winds, and constant freeze–thaw cycles, asphalt shingle roofs in Denver take a beating year after year.

At Ernie’s Gutter, we work alongside roofing systems every day. We see how asphalt shingles age, where they fail first, and how poor drainage and gutter problems often make roof damage worse. If this is your first time hearing this, here’s the key takeaway: asphalt shingles can work well in Denver, but only when they’re installed correctly, maintained properly, and supported by a functioning gutter system.

This page explains how asphalt shingles actually perform in Denver, common problems we see, realistic lifespan expectations, and when repairs make sense versus full replacement.


Why Asphalt Shingles Behave Differently in Denver

Denver’s climate is tough on roofing materials, especially asphalt shingles. The issue isn’t one single factor—it’s how multiple weather conditions stack up over time.

What affects asphalt shingles most in this area:

  • High UV exposure due to elevation, which dries out shingles faster

  • Frequent small hail events that knock granules loose

  • Rapid temperature swings that cause expansion and contraction

  • Freeze–thaw cycles that work water into seams and nail penetrations

  • Strong winds that stress seal strips and shingle edges

On many homes in Lakewood, Arvada, Wheat Ridge, and Aurora, we see shingles wear unevenly depending on slope exposure. South- and west-facing roof planes usually age faster than shaded areas. From the ground, the roof may look fine. Up close, the damage tells a different story.

Types of Asphalt Shingles Commonly Used on Denver Homes

Not all asphalt shingles are the same, and some perform better here than others.

Three-Tab Asphalt Shingles

These are thinner and lighter. They’re still found on older Denver homes but tend to fail sooner in our climate due to wind and hail exposure.

Architectural (Dimensional) Asphalt Shingles

These are thicker, more durable, and far more common on homes built from the late 1990s through today. They hold up better against wind and temperature changes.

Impact-Resistant Asphalt Shingles

Designed to handle hail better, these shingles often last longer in Denver and may qualify for insurance discounts depending on the policy.

Choosing the right shingle type matters, but so does proper installation and drainage.


Common Asphalt Shingle Problems We See in Denver

During inspections, these issues come up repeatedly on asphalt shingle roofs:

  • Granule loss from repeated hail impacts

  • Brittle or cracked shingles caused by UV exposure

  • Seal strip failure that allows wind uplift

  • Exposed or popped nails after freeze–thaw movement

  • Lifted shingles near roof edges and valleys

Many of these problems don’t cause immediate leaks. They quietly shorten the roof’s lifespan until a storm or heavy rain exposes the damage.


How Gutters and Drainage Affect Asphalt Shingle Roofs

Because this page lives on the Ernie’s Gutter site, this part matters.

Asphalt shingles rely on proper water flow off the roof. When gutters aren’t working correctly, water backs up where it shouldn’t.

Poor gutter performance leads to:

  • Water spilling behind the gutter and soaking roof edges

  • Ice dams forming along the eaves

  • Fascia and decking rot beneath shingles

  • Faster shingle deterioration near roof edges

We often see asphalt shingle damage that started as a gutter problem. Clean, properly pitched gutters extend the life of the roof above them.


Repair vs Replacement: What Makes Sense for Asphalt Shingles

Not every asphalt shingle issue requires a full roof replacement. The right decision depends on the age of the roof and the extent of damage.

Repairs Often Make Sense When:

  • Damage is isolated to a small area

  • The roof is under 12–15 years old

  • Shingles are still flexible

  • Granule loss is minimal

Replacement Is Usually Smarter When:

  • Damage is widespread

  • Shingles are brittle across multiple slopes

  • Granules are collecting heavily in gutters

  • The roof is approaching the end of its lifespan

Waiting too long often turns a repairable roof into a replacement project.


How Long Asphalt Shingles Really Last in Denver

Manufacturer warranties don’t reflect Denver’s climate reality.

Based on what we see in the field:

  • Standard asphalt shingles: 15–22 years

  • Architectural shingles: 18–25 years

  • Impact-resistant shingles: 20–30 years

Sun exposure, hail frequency, installation quality, and gutter performance all influence lifespan.


When Asphalt Shingle Roofs Should Be Inspected

You should have your asphalt shingle roof inspected if:

  • It’s over 12–15 years old

  • You’ve had recent hail or windstorms

  • You notice granules in gutters or downspouts

  • Shingles appear curled, cracked, or uneven

  • Water stains appear inside the home

Early inspections catch problems while they’re still manageable.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are asphalt shingles a good choice for Denver homes?
Yes, especially architectural or impact-resistant shingles installed correctly.

How does hail affect asphalt shingles?
Hail knocks granules loose and weakens shingles over time, even when damage isn’t obvious.

Can damaged asphalt shingles be repaired?
Often yes, if the damage is limited and the roof isn’t too old.

Do gutters really affect asphalt shingle lifespan?
Absolutely. Poor drainage accelerates roof edge damage and ice dam formation.

How often should asphalt shingle roofs be inspected in Denver?
At least once a year and after major storms.

Are impact-resistant shingles worth it here?
In many cases, yes. They hold up better to hail and may lower insurance premiums.

What causes shingles to lift in wind?
Seal strip failure, brittle shingles, and improper installation.

Is granule loss always a problem?
Some loss is normal, but heavy buildup in gutters is a warning sign.
